What You Need To Know About Bunions

You are more likely to develop a bunion if you have a genetic bone deformity which causes your big toe joint to protrude outward. Women are more likely to develop bunions because of wearing shoes which are too narrow. The big toe joint rubs against the inside of the narrow shoe, eventually causing a bunion.

Bunions begin small, and small bunions can be treated at home. You can try:

  • Wearing comfortable, wider shoes
  • Taking pain medication like Tylenol or ibuprofen
  • Taping your foot to cushion and support the bunion
  • Wearing inserts or pads in your shoes

As the bunion grows bigger, more and more bone is involved. Larger bunions need to be evaluated by a podiatrist. Our podiatrist may recommend:

  • Cortisone injections around the bunion to reduce swelling and pain
  • Custom orthotics to support your foot and the bunion
  • Splints to help realign your toe and foot
  • Bunion surgery, known as a bunionectomy, to remove the bunion
